A Culinary Night at Broadway Oyster Bar
After work today, I went to Broadway Oyster Bar with a friend. Located in the old town of St. Louis, the red brick wall and blues music made us feel the Southern vibe before even stepping inside 😊. Though we're in Missouri, our stomachs had already flown to Louisiana! The staff recommended the classic combo. The first spoonful of gumbo warmed my throat and stomach with its thick broth, sausage, and seafood 🌟. When the jambalaya pot was uncovered, the rice soaked up the essence of tomatoes and Cajun spices, packed with shrimp and chicken. My friend exclaimed while scooping, "This portion is so generous!" We devoured it, scraping the plate clean 🥘 As for the oysters—in the Midwest, you really can’t expect too much. They were plump and briny, but not particularly memorable. Consider them a refreshing interlude in this meal 🦪.
